The Lament of the Sky's Orphan
In the vast expanse of the cosmos, where the stars twinkle like scattered diamonds and the moon casts its silver glow upon the world, there was a realm that few could see and fewer still could understand. This realm was known as the Parallel Poets, a group of beings who lived in a world where the sky was divided into two distinct realms: the blue sky, which was bright and cheerful, and the darkening clouds, which harbored shadows and mysteries.
In the blue sky realm, there lived an orphan named Sky. His parents had vanished during a great celestial storm, leaving him to wander the sky alone. He had no memory of his past, only the vague sensation that he was meant for something greater than his humble beginnings. Sky was known for his deep blue eyes that seemed to pierce through the fabric of reality, reflecting a soul that was both curious and lost.
One day, while Sky was gazing into the vastness of the sky, a figure appeared before him. It was a being of ethereal light, with wings that shimmered like the morning dew. The figure spoke in a voice that was both soothing and haunting.
"I am the Parallel Poet," it said. "I have been watching you, Sky. You are the Orphan of the Blue Sky, a child of destiny."
Sky's heart raced. "What does that mean?"
The Parallel Poet smiled. "It means you are the key to understanding the great mystery of the Parallel Poets. The sky is not just a place; it is a mirror of the human soul. The blue sky represents hope and light, while the darkening clouds symbolize fear and the unknown."
Sky's curiosity was piqued. "But how do I unlock this mystery?"
The Parallel Poet's eyes glowed with an ancient wisdom. "You must journey through the darkening clouds and find the truth within yourself. Only then can you truly understand the parallel realms and your place within them."
With that, the Parallel Poet vanished, leaving Sky alone once more. But this time, he was no longer the same. A sense of purpose filled him, and he set out on a journey that would change his life forever.
As Sky ventured into the darkening clouds, he encountered strange creatures and faced daunting challenges. He met a creature with the ability to see the past and the future, who told him tales of the great wars that had raged in the sky. He encountered a sorcerer who could manipulate the elements, and a warrior who could bend the very fabric of reality.
Each encounter brought Sky closer to understanding the Parallel Poets and his own destiny. He learned that the blue sky and the darkening clouds were not separate, but two sides of the same coin. They were the yin and yang of existence, the duality that made life what it was.
As Sky delved deeper into his journey, he began to understand that his parents had not vanished but had been taken by the Parallel Poets to be trained in the ways of the sky. They had been chosen for a purpose greater than themselves, and now Sky was to continue their legacy.
The climax of Sky's journey came when he faced the greatest challenge of all: the choice between the blue sky and the darkening clouds. He had to decide which realm he belonged to, and whether he would embrace the light or the shadow.
In a moment of profound clarity, Sky realized that he could not choose one realm over the other. He was both the blue sky and the darkening clouds, the light and the shadow. He was the embodiment of the Parallel Poets, the one who could bridge the gap between the two realms.
With this realization, Sky returned to the blue sky, not as an orphan, but as the Orphan of the Blue Sky, the one who could see the truth of the sky and guide others to do the same.
